I had some of the same problem.... your ideas may vary, but here's what worked for me.
basal spray for the easy to get to stem stuff
foliar spray for the dense stuff
LOOOONNNNGGGG hose to take into the dense stuff and spray the foliage.. hand sprayer... aim into the air from UPWIND.... and let breeze carry spray onto foliage beyond reach of your hose.
Do this all around the edges of the thick mott... wait for 1-2 weeks so you can see where you went because leaves are looking poorly.
Go back thru getting new stuff... maybe wind is in different direction and you can get different trees.
Next year you should be able to get further into the thicket and do the same thing.
Took me 4 to 6 years to get all the way thru some of the dense areas... but now there are NO mesquites of any size on the place.
